The Energy Internet, also known as the Internet of Energy (IoE), aims to transform the traditional electricity system into a highly interconnected, intelligent network where energy production, storage, and consumption are coordinated in real time. Its primary goal is to automate both the transfer and consumption of energy, improving efficiency, reducing waste, and enabling greater use of renewable energy sources .
The ultimate goal of the Energy Internet is to create a sustainable, intelligent, and resilient energy ecosystem where energy is delivered efficiently, renewable sources are maximized, and all components—from power plants to homes—communicate and cooperate seamlessly to meet dynamic energy demands .
